I have changed none of the settings on the PC I use with PGP, but the "Cannot establish connection with the PGP SDK service" error message has appeared for the first time today. This has obviously stopped me from starting or accessing PGP.

I also get a "blue screen" on startup (luckily not fatal) that tells me that a .vxd file is missing. I have tried restoring a working copy of the registry, but this didn't help.

Having changed nothing, this is totally baffling me and as a very casual user of PGP I am not too technical with it.

Can anybody help please?
 
I had the same problem. It turned out to be my "Client for Network" had be removed and PGP wouldn't start. Once I put the Microsoft Client for Network back on, it worked fine.
